Stuart/Martin County Chamber Honors International Training
as the 2025 CareerConnect Martin Employer of the Year
 
STUART — International Training, a Stuart-based tech company has been honored as the CareerConnect Martin Employer of the Year for 2025. Leaders of the Stuart/Martin County Chamber and the Martin Chamber Foundation announced Saturday at the Chamber’s annual Installation & Awards Gala, presented by Loving Chiropractic of Stuart.
 
Martin Chamber Foundation Executive Director Angela Hoffman said International Training is a leading provider of Learning Management Systems and database management solutions for businesses throughout the world. They have stood out with their support and collaboration in the mission to provide workforce development and training opportunities for Martin County residents.
 
The business, led by Stephanie Miele and Brian Carney, is one of 60 local businesses who partner for free with Martin Chamber Foundation’s signature program called CareerConnect Martin that focuses on core competencies, the right connections, and building confidence for better career opportunities.
 
“They were an early adopter of our program,” said Gina Masters, Workforce Development Coordinator for CareerConnect Martin. “They also worked with us to develop the orientation and soft-skill training modules we use with all of our program participants.”
 
The four eLearning training modules are part of an individualized workforce development program that includes personalized meetings with career coaches, a DISC assessment, and support to overcome whatever obstacles job seekers face when seeking a career.
 
Recently, International Training welcomed Isabella, a CareerConnect Martin program participant, for a Trial Employment Opportunity. Also known as a TEO, this element of the program matches motivated and qualified participants with local businesses with appropriate job openings. Before the trial period was over, Isabella was hired full-time and is thriving in her new role with International Training.

About the Martin Chamber Foundation
 
The Martin Chamber Foundation is a 501c3 charity created by the Stuart/Martin County Chamber of Commerce to support economic prosperity for Martin County residents by strengthening and growing workforce development, education & entrepreneurship.
